What is a Volunteer Background Check?

Let's cut through the jargon. A volunteer background check isn't just a quick Google search or calling that reference who happens to be the applicant's best friend. It's a professional-grade screening process that digs deep into public records, government databases, and verified sources to paint a complete picture of who's joining your organization.

Here's what a legitimate background check brings to the table (and why each piece matters more than you think):

Identity verification isn't just checking a driver's license - it's a sophisticated process that cross-references multiple data points to ensure Mary Smith is actually your Mary Smith, not one of the other 47,000 Mary Smiths in the database.

Sex offender registry checks aren't just for one state anymore (because news flash - people move). We're talking all 50 states, because that clean record in Ohio doesn't mean squat if there's a red flag in Oregon.

But here's where it gets real: County-level criminal record searches. Why? Because most criminal records can be found at the county level. Those local courthouses hold the juicy details that national databases miss. We chase those records wherever your volunteer has laid their head.

Here's the kicker that most organizations miss: Ongoing monitoring. That squeaky-clean volunteer from last year's check? Things change. Real-time alerts about new criminal activity mean you're not waiting until next year's renewal to find out about last month's DUI.
